Noobo 2nd Gear August 14, 2018 Share August 14, 2018 I went thru a similar situation like you - mine a Golden Retriever- only 6 years plus left this world 2 days back because of severe gastro intestinal issues and was bleeding profusely- many dog owners in my Neighbourhood were more than willing to donate their ð blood for mine- more than 5 came and all were rejected Cos mine was DEA-ve and all the other 5 were DEA+ve... and after 2 days of hospitalization and when the 6th donor came he called it quits and left us all as he was bleeding profusely- after this incident I too wonder why there is no proper blood bank in Singapore nor a requirement by owners or Vets to tag the blood type..... it was a harrowing experience to loose a loved one whom never asked for anything except attention and gave nothing but joy and love with his silly antics ...
